A traffic collision on State Route 1 (SR-1) in Bodega, CA, caused significant disruptions to traffic flow this morning. The incident occurred around 8:53 AM when a white pickup truck was involved in a solo vehicle collision. The northbound lane was blocked, leading to delays for morning commuters.
Emergency services responded quickly, deploying multiple units to manage the scene and control traffic. A tow truck was summoned to remove the vehicle, which was rendered non-drivable due to the collision. Lane closures were established to ensure the safety of both responders and motorists.
As the situation developed, traffic backups were reported, impacting the flow of vehicles in the area. Commuters were advised to seek alternate routes to avoid delays. The prompt response from emergency services helped to minimize the disruption, allowing for the eventual removal of the vehicle and the reopening of the roadway.
